Cautions and Considerations
While this asset is versatile, there are scenarios where it should be used carefully. In small sizes or crowded layouts, the details might get lost, so it's best suited for larger formats. On complex backgrounds or in low-contrast designs, the asset may not stand out effectively. For minimalist branding or professional corporate materials, it might not fit the tone unless intentionally incorporated as a decorative element.
Designers should test it in black and white to ensure readability and check contrast on both light and dark backgrounds. Previewing at small and large sizes helps determine its effectiveness in different contexts. Testing print quality and reviewing file formats like EPS or SVG is crucial before finalizing any commercial design.
